Get to Know the Role:
The Associate Merchant for Fleece is responsible for driving the strategic execution and daily management of a high-volume, product-led category. This role requires a unique blend of strategic analytical thinking and hands-on, tactile product passion.
You will manage and develop an Assistant Merchant, analyze and report on sales data on a weekly basis, and collaborate with cross-functional partners to drive category growth. Simultaneously, you will be immersed in the product lifecycle, driving execution from end to end, which includes partnering on sample management, helping facilitate and manage Purchase Orders, and handling fabric commits with vendors in partnership with Planning and Production.
What You’ll Do:
- Drive and execute a strategic Omni product vision and business plan for the Fleece category through seamless communication and coordination with Design, Production, and Planning.
- Directly manage, coach, and develop one Assistant Merchant, establishing clear goals, prioritizing daily tasks, and fostering their professional growth within the merchandising career track.
- Drive end-to-end execution of the product lifecycle by partnering on sample management, facilitating and managing Purchase Orders (POs), and securing fabric commits with vendors in close collaboration with Planning and Production.
- Analyze and report out on sales performance weekly, identifying immediate volume and margin opportunities to maximize topline revenue and mitigate markdown risks.
- Partner with the Planning team monthly to manage the Open-to-Buy, dynamically adjusting strategies based on current category trends.
- Collaborate with Planning to rank the landed assortment, optimizing buy quantities based on targeted category opportunities.
- Develop a comprehensive understanding of the full fleece assortment, tracking its development from initial concept to final execution across all styles, silhouettes, and fabrications.
- Maintain total data integrity across all internal merchandising systems and assortment tools, tracking style details, colorways, and delivery cadences from concept to site launch to ensure clear assortment visibility at all times.
- Keep a constant pulse on the competitive landscape, benchmarking both Brick & Mortar and Digital competitors to make informed, brand-right business decisions.

Get to Know AEO
American Eagle Outfitters, Inc. (NYSE: AEO) is a leading global specialty retailer with a portfolio of beloved apparel brands including American Eagle, Aerie, OFFL/NE by Aerie, Todd Snyder and Unsubscribed.
Rooted in optimism, inclusivity and authenticity, AEO’s brands empower every customer to celebrate their unique personal style by offering casual, comfortable, timeless outfitting and high-quality products that are made to last. In addition to a robust e-commerce business, we operate stores in the United States, Canada and Mexico, with merchandise available in more than 30 countries through a global network of license partners.
